Strafford had already won two in a row and they went ahead and made it three on Monday. They put the hurt on the Diamond Wildcats with a sharp 3-0 victory. The Indians have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Wildcats, too.
Strafford's not only won, but also showed off some consistency: keeping Diamond between 16 and 17 points across their sets.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-17, 25-17, 25-16.
Strafford's record is now 20-4-1. As for Diamond, their loss dropped their record down to 14-8-1.
